I hugged myself as the nippy gust of the evening caressed my body while I walked down the streets. I forgot to grab my jacket and my purse. I only have a few cash on my jeans pocket and I’ve been condemning myself for the last few minutes for doing so.

I also suddenly realized I have no clue where I’m going. I spent the next few minutes wandering around and trying to figure out where I could stay for an hour or so. I wanted to visit Eun Hye, but that would be the first place mom would check if she finds out I sneaked out. 

I halt into a stop when I saw the café I promised myself I wouldn’t set my foot into. My stomach kept on grumbling though, reminding me I hadn’t finish my dinner when the argument broke out. Pushing aside my uncertainty, I entered the café. When I went to the counter, it wasn’t Kyungsoo who attended my order. In fact, I don’t see him around the café, which was a bit strange because he’s usually in the cafe every Wednesday night.

I sat on an empty booth and my order arrived after a minute. While I ate my food, I decided to just walk around the city and maybe sit in the park and try to collect my thoughts there. After I finished my food, the doors of the café burst open and a flustered Kyungsoo sauntered inside the café; his phone stuck on his one ear. He seemed to be having an important conversation with someone, considering how serious he looked.

“Kyungsoo.” I called out to him as I got on my feet and approached him.

“Su Ji.” Kyungsoo said after hanging up his phone.

“Are you okay?” I asked him. Kyungsoo opened his mouth and then he shut it again. He fumbled on his phone and I knew something’s not right. “Kyungsoo, what is it?” I asked him again, “Is it Eun Hye?”

“No, she’s fine.” Kyungsoo said. He suddenly looked tired. “It’s…Jongin.”

My heart sank. “What about him?” I echoed, taking a closer step towards him. “Did something happen? Is he…okay?”

“He’s missing, Su Ji.” he said worriedly.

Then, he explained to me that Jongin had been missing since this morning. He said Jongin had told his grandma about what really happened the night of the accident. Jongin’s grandma handled the news rather poorly. She was sent to the hospital because of severe stress, but he quickly reassured me that she’s okay now; that she only needed an emergency treatment.

“And Jongin?” I croaked, hearing the anxiety in my own voice. “Why—where did he go?”

Kyungsoo hesitated. “We don’t know yet.” he replied, “When Jongin’s grandma was taken to the hospital last night, he went with them. Noo Ri thought Jongin was waiting for them by the lobby while their grandma was resting after the treatment, but he wasn’t there. When they got home this morning, Jongin was nowhere to be found. Then, she noticed his car was gone, too.”

“He ran away.” I supplied anxiously .

“Maybe.” Kyungsoo replied unsurely, he sighed tiresomely while he sat on a spare chair near him. “We’ve been looking everywhere for him since this afternoon when Noo Ri said she hasn’t received any calls from him since he left. But we couldn’t find him anywhere.” he turned to me with hopeful stare, “Did he call you or something? Sent you any message?”

I shook my head hopelessly, recalling our huge fight. “No, he didn’t.”

“Well, do you know any place you think where he could be staying right now?” Kyungsoo asked once more, “You two are pretty close after all.”

It appeared to me that Kyungsoo hadn’t meant to say the last sentence because his eyes turned wide from quick panic the second the words came out of his mouth. And perhaps it was not the appropriate time, given the situation, but my face turned bright red from embarrassment all the same.

“I’m—sorry—” Kyungsoo stuttered, apparently disoriented perhaps because of the situation. “That was stupid—”

“It’s alright,” I told him awkwardly as I embarrassedly shifted my gaze away from him.

Then, Noo Ri came inside the shop, her eyes were red and puffy. She promptly turned to Kyungsoo and mentioned that Chanyeol was talking to some of Jongin’s old friends in a nearby town where he might be staying. Kyungsoo went to the patio and called Chanyeol at once. Meanwhile, I asked Noo Ri to take a seat because she looked like she’s going to collapse any moment now.

After taking a few deep breaths, Noo Ri expressed to me in hushed tone how much she’s worried about her little brother. Their grandma was upset with him for lying to them, but at the same time, he’s still their family.

“I got mad at him too.” Noo Ri admitted dolefully. I held her hand when I noticed her trying to hold back her tears. “He lied to us. But then I thought Jongin wouldn’t do that on purpose. He may be stubborn but he’s not heartless. I already lost a sister, I don’t want to lose my little brother, too.”

“You’re not going to lose him.” I reassured her, but I felt worried myself. “We’ll find him and he’ll be alright.” Noo Ri gave me a sad smile and squeezed my hand.

Kyungsoo came back after a moment with an information on where Jongin might be staying. Noo Ri stood up right away and went outside to her car. I was about to go after her, but then Kyungsoo stopped me and told me to just wait because it was already getting late. I insisted more but he did the same thing.

“I’ll call you when we find him. I promise.” Kyungsoo assured me. Then he ran off outside, joined Noo Ri in her car and they both rushed to the streets.

Feeling helpless, I sat floppily on the chair where Noo Ri used to sit seconds ago. Then, I remembered I forgot my cell phone back at home as well. I put my hand over my chest and feel the way my heart beat wildly. Various scenarios of what could possibly happened to Jongin rushed inside my head. Where could he possibly be hiding?

I sat there, thinking hard, until something struck my mind. I wasn’t entirely sure if he’s there but it’s worth the shot. I urgently left the café and ran across the street, ignoring the icy puff of air whipping my body. After a few more turns and tripping on my feet, I finally arrived at my destination—Ja Won’s apartment building.

Jongin told me once that no one, including his family and friends, knew about him coming into this building and so I thought he could be hiding in here. My heart was on a jittery rampage as I jogged along the hallway as soon as the elevator slid opened. I immediately pressed the intercom when I reached Ja Won’s unit. I pressed it again and again and again but there was no answer. I called out his name, even though I know for sure I’m his least favorite person at the moment, several times while knocking and abusing the intercom, but still no answer.

Dejected, I walked back to the elevator. But then something in the corner of my eyes gleamed. I looked over my right and noticed a fire exit door at the end of the hallway. After staring at it some more, a thought seized me again. The moment the elevator slid opened, I quickly pressed the button up to the top floor.

It wouldn’t hurt if I check the rooftop of the apartment building, right?

I stepped out of the elevator moments later and used the stairs leading up to the rooftop. I pushed open the door and the cool gust of wind blew on my face when I stepped out. I rubbed my hands together to warm myself up. A huge heating up unit was standing across the door, blocking my view of the entire rooftop. I walked around it and scanned the area.

It was quite spacious and dimly lit; only a few of the lamp posts lining the fences bordering the edges were lit up. Apart from the huge packaged heating up units and pipes on the edge of the cemented floors, I noted a basketball ring stand on one of the corners of the building, as well as the two sets of bleachers adjacent to it.

While I make my way towards the basketball ring stand, I noticed something by the bleachers. I stopped walking and turned to the bleacher on my left side. I climbed up the bleacher, to the second row where a leather jacket was resting. I picked it up and felt its smooth material. I caught a familiar whiff of mint. I froze suddenly when I heard a faint sound just behind the bleacher I was standing on.

Slowly and reluctantly, I went to the edge of the bleacher, thinking maybe what I heard was merely a flurry of the wind. I stopped from walking when I saw a tall figure with his one hand on his pocket standing by the fence, just a few meters away from where  I was standing.
